What is an Electric Flanged Soft Seal Butterfly Valve?

An electric flanged soft seal butterfly valve is a valve used to regulate the flow of liquids or gases within a pipeline. The core mechanism of the valve consists of a disc or plate that pivots around a central axis. When the valve is open, the disc is positioned parallel to the flow direction, allowing the fluid to pass through. When the valve is closed, the disc rotates to block the flow. The “electric” aspect of these valves refers to the electric actuator that drives the valve’s operation. This actuator eliminates the need for manual intervention, making the valve an ideal choice for automation in processes where precise control is essential. The flanged design means the valve has flanged connections that allow for easy installation and secure sealing when attached to the pipeline. The soft seal typically refers to the use of elastic materials, such as rubber, in the sealing area to ensure a tight and reliable seal, minimizing leakage and providing long-lasting performance.
